Cleveland’s history in aviation will be the next topic of the Cleveland Stories series at the Music Box Supper Club. Dr. Edward Pershey of the Western Reserve Historical Society and local aviation expert Tom Piraino will talk about the role Cleveland played in the development of airplanes.

As usual, there is a special, themed 3-course meal available for $20. This week it features Kitty Hawk Shrimp Bisque, Airline Chicken Supreme and B-52 custard. And yes, it will be better than the food you used to get on airplanes before they started to cut costs and eliminated meals.

The program itself is free. Call the club at 216-242-1250 to make a meal reservation. Door are at 6; the program starts at 7:30pm.
